mod args;
use crate::args::Parser;
use std::process::ExitCode;
fn parse_args() -> Result<bool, String> {
let mut options = args::Options::new();
let help_idx = options.push(
args::OptionBuilder::default()
.short('h')
.long("help")
.description("display this and exit")
.build().unwrap());
let version_idx = options.push(
args::OptionBuilder::default()
.short('V')
.long("version")
.description("display version and exit")
.build().unwrap());
let verbose_idx = options.push(
args::OptionBuilder::default()
.long("verbose")
.description("be verbose")
.build().unwrap());
let test_idx = options.push(
args::OptionBuilder::default()
.short('t')
.long("test")
.description("testing")
.value(args::ValueRequirement::Required("FILE"))
.build().unwrap());
let parser = args::ShortAndLongParser::new();
let args = parser.run(&mut options, std::env::args())?;
let ref help = options[help_idx];
if help.is_set() {
parser.print_help(&options);
return Ok(true);
}
let ref version = options[version_idx];
if version.is_set() {
println!("Version is 0.0.1");
return Ok(true);
}
let ref verbose = options[verbose_idx];
let ref test = options[test_idx];
println!("verbose: {}", verbose.is_set());
println!("test: {:?}", test.value());
println!("args: {:?}", args.args);
Ok(false)
}
fn main() -> ExitCode {
match parse_args() {
Ok(exit) => {
if exit {
return ExitCode::SUCCESS;
}
}
Err(msg) => {
eprintln!("{}", msg);
return ExitCode::FAILURE;
}
}
ExitCode::SUCCESS
}
